SpaceX’s Starlink may land in SriLanka next after President Ranil Wickremesinghe approved the satellite internet service. President Wickremesinghe greenlit the launch of Starlink internet in SriLanka over the weekend. Starlink internet may launch in SriLanka after a two-week public consultation period.
Starlink received a license in SriLanka, enabling it to start operations there. According to the Sri Lankan President’s office, the local telecommunications regulator issued a license to SpaceX, permitting it to provide Starlink services in the country. It is also providing free internet to schools in remote areas.
